Ask anyone in the organization what he or she thinks you do. The answer? “It is simple. Multiply my hours by my salary, subtract the tax and write a cheque”. If only it were that easy. When it comes to handling employee benefits, there is a lot to know. Is the benefit taxable? Non-taxable? Partially taxable? Handling payroll sounds like a simple proposition but NOT. A payroll department/ section are about providing service and control. Employees and managers across the organization ask as many questions, generate many tasks for the payroll department (especially after each payroll run), and set off many related reporting and control activities. Managing the payroll departmental process/function that is becoming increasingly complex requires a high level of expertise. This essential four-day seminar is designed to concentrate on the management of key aspects of the payroll operation, providing practical advice on major areas of risk, both in terms of compliance and in protecting the payroll itself from fraud and disaster.

A payroll career is based around on-the-job training. This course equips payroll staff with an understanding of the reasons and methodology processes behind payroll and when those procedures may need changing.

 

This program is meant for those who have previously worked in payroll but want to ensure they are updated with current information, Supervisors who need an in-depth understanding of payroll processes. Participants will include: Payroll Managers, Officers, Administrators and Assistants, HR Managers and staff, Finance Managers and staffs interested in taking steps towards transforming their current practices into Payroll Administration.
